49 /* Upper bound on the string length of an integer converted to string.
50 302 / 1000 is ceil (log10 (2.0)). Subtract 1 for the sign bit;
51 add 1 for integer division truncation; add 1 more for a minus sign. */
52 #define INT_STRLEN_BOUND(t) ((sizeof (t) * CHAR_BIT - 1) * 302 / 1000 + 2)
53
54 /* ISDIGIT differs from isdigit, as follows:
55 - Its arg may be any int or unsigned int; it need not be an unsigned char.
56 - It's guaranteed to evaluate its argument exactly once.
57 - It's typically faster.
58 Posix 1003.2-1992 section 2.5.2.1 page 50 lines 1556-1558 says that
59 only '0' through '9' are digits. Prefer ISDIGIT to isdigit unless
60 it's important to use the locale's definition of 'digit' even when the
61 host does not conform to Posix. */
62 #define ISDIGIT(c) ((unsigned) (c) - '0' <= 9)

79 /* Return the name of the new backup file for file FILE,
80 allocated with malloc. Return 0 if out of memory.
81 FILE must not end with a '/' unless it is the root directory.
82 Do not call this function if backup_type == none. */
83
84 char *
find_backup_file_name(const char * file,enum backup_type backup_type)85 find_backup_file_name (const char *file, enum backup_type backup_type)
86 {
87 size_t backup_suffix_size_max;
88 size_t file_len = strlen (file);
89 size_t numbered_suffix_size_max = INT_STRLEN_BOUND (int) + 4;
90 char *s;
91 const char *suffix = simple_backup_suffix;
92
93 /* Allow room for simple or '.~N~' backups. */
94 backup_suffix_size_max = strlen (simple_backup_suffix) + 1;
95 if (HAVE_DIR && backup_suffix_size_max < numbered_suffix_size_max)
96 backup_suffix_size_max = numbered_suffix_size_max;
97
98 s = (char *) malloc (file_len + backup_suffix_size_max
99 + numbered_suffix_size_max);
100 if (s)
101 {
102 strcpy (s, file);
103
104 #if HAVE_DIR
105 if (backup_type != simple)
106 {
107 int highest_backup;
108 size_t dir_len = last_component (s) - s;
109
110 strcpy (s + dir_len, ".");
111 highest_backup = max_backup_version (file + dir_len, s);
112 if (! (backup_type == numbered_existing && highest_backup == 0))
113 {
114 char *numbered_suffix = s + (file_len + backup_suffix_size_max);
115 sprintf (numbered_suffix, ".~%d~", highest_backup + 1);
116 suffix = numbered_suffix;
117 }
118 strcpy (s, file);
119 }
120 #endif /* HAVE_DIR */
121
122 addext (s, suffix, '~');
123 }
124 return s;
125 }

129 /* Return the number of the highest-numbered backup file for file
130 FILE in directory DIR. If there are no numbered backups
131 of FILE in DIR, or an error occurs reading DIR, return 0.
132 */
133
134 static int
max_backup_version(const char * file,const char * dir)135 max_backup_version (const char *file, const char *dir)
136 {
137 DIR *dirp;
138 struct dirent *dp;
139 int highest_version;
140 int this_version;
141 size_t file_name_length;
142
143 dirp = opendir (dir);
144 if (!dirp)
145 return 0;
146
147 highest_version = 0;
148 file_name_length = strlen (file);
149
150 while ((dp = readdir (dirp)) != 0)
151 {
152 if (!REAL_DIR_ENTRY (dp) || strlen (dp->d_name) < file_name_length + 4)
153 continue;
154
155 this_version = version_number (file, dp->d_name, file_name_length);
156 if (this_version > highest_version)
157 highest_version = this_version;
158 }
159 if (closedir (dirp))
160 return 0;
161 return highest_version;
162 }
163
164 /* If BACKUP is a numbered backup of BASE, return its version number;
165 otherwise return 0. BASE_LENGTH is the length of BASE.
166 */
167
168 static int
version_number(const char * base,const char * backup,size_t base_length)169 version_number (const char *base, const char *backup, size_t base_length)
170 {
171 int version;
172 const char *p;
173
174 version = 0;
175 if (strncmp (base, backup, base_length) == 0
176 && backup[base_length] == '.'
177 && backup[base_length + 1] == '~')
178 {
179 for (p = &backup[base_length + 2]; ISDIGIT (*p); ++p)
180 version = version * 10 + *p - '0';
181 if (p[0] != '~' || p[1])
182 version = 0;
183 }
184 return version;
185 }
186 #endif /* HAVE_DIR */
